The acute effects of an ultramarathon on biventricular function and ventricular arrhythmias in master athletes.

Abstract

AIMS

Endurance sports practice has significantly increased over the last decades, with a growing proportion of participants older than 40 years. Although the benefits of moderate regular exercise are well known, concerns exist regarding the potential negative effects induced by extreme endurance sport. The aim of this study was to analyse the acute effects of an ultramarathon race on the electrocardiogram (ECG), biventricular function, and ventricular arrhythmias in a population of master athletes.

METHODS AND RESULTS

Master athletes participating in an ultramarathon (50 km, 600 m of elevation gain) with no history of heart disease were recruited. A single-lead ECG was recorded continuously from the day before to the end of the race. Echocardiography and 12-lead resting ECG were performed before and at the end of the race. The study sample consisted of 68 healthy non-professional master athletes. Compared with baseline, R-wave amplitude in V1 and QTc duration were higher after the race (P < 0.001). Exercise-induced isolated premature ventricular beats were observed in 7% of athletes; none showed non-sustained ventricular tachycardia before or during the race. Left ventricular ejection fraction, global longitudinal strain (GLS), and twisting did not significantly differ before and after the race. After the race, no significant differences were found in right ventricular inflow and outflow tract dimensions, fractional area change, s', and free wall GLS.

CONCLUSION

In master endurance athletes running an ultra-marathon, exercise-induced ventricular dysfunction, or relevant ventricular arrhythmias was not detected. These results did not confirm the hypothesis of a detrimental acute effect of strenuous exercise on the heart.

摘要

目的

在过去几十年中,耐力运动的参与度显著增加,40岁以上参与者的比例不断上升。尽管适度定期锻炼的益处广为人知,但对于极限耐力运动可能产生的负面影响仍存在担忧。本研究的目的是分析超级马拉松比赛对一群成年运动员心电图(ECG)、双心室功能和室性心律失常的急性影响。

方法与结果

招募了没有心脏病史且参加超级马拉松(50公里,海拔升高600米)的成年运动员。从比赛前一天到比赛结束连续记录单导联心电图。在比赛前和比赛结束时进行超声心动图检查和静息12导联心电图检查。研究样本包括68名健康的非职业成年运动员。与基线相比,比赛后V1导联R波振幅和QTc间期更高(P < 0.001)。7%的运动员观察到运动诱发的孤立性室性早搏;比赛前或比赛期间均未出现非持续性室性心动过速。比赛前后左心室射血分数、整体纵向应变(GLS)和扭转无显著差异。比赛后,右心室流入和流出道尺寸、面积变化分数、s'和游离壁GLS无显著差异。

结论

在参加超级马拉松的成年耐力运动员中,未检测到运动诱发的心室功能障碍或相关的室性心律失常。这些结果并未证实剧烈运动对心脏有有害急性影响的假设。
